Chapter 23 Summary

Vivian leaves the casino and, as she walks through the fog, the man in the mask robs her at gunpoint. When he walks away with Vivian's purse, Marlowe gets the drop on him and gets Vivian's purse back for her.

Of course, Vivian is rather surprised to see Marlowe and she wonders what he is doing there. Marlowe explains that he is there because Eddie Mars wanted to see him about her husband, but he didn't have any useful information for him. Vivian was under the impression that Marlowe wasn't looking for Regan so Marlowe explains to her that everyone keeps throwing Regan at him and he wants to know why. He visited Mars to see if he had anything useful.
